Application
Wall luminaire with single-sided light output for illumination and design tasks in architecture. The luminaire can be installed with the light distribution opening upwards or downwards.

Installation
Undo hexagon socket head screws (wrench size 3 mm) up to the stop and disassemble the mounting plate.
Pass the power connecting cable through the cable entry in the mounting plate.
The installed black gasket insert is intended for cables ø < 10 mm.
For cables ø 10-12 mm the enclosed grey gasket insert must be used.
In case of through-wiring replace the factory installed dummy plug with the enclosed corresponding gasket insert.
At the same time, use the enclosed synthetic cone-thrust collar between gasket insert and thrust screw (wrench size 22 mm) (see sketch).

Ensure correct directionality towards the area to be illuminated.
Fix the mounting plate with enclosed or any other suitable fixing material onto the mounting surface.
Tighten screw cable gland.
Make earth conductor connection and electrical connection to the connecting terminal (plug connection).
For digital control please use the connecting terminal DA, DA.
In case this terminal is not used the luminaire will be operated at full light output.
Make sure that gasket is positioned correctly.
Push plug into coupler as far as it will go.
Place the luminaire onto the mounting plate and fix it.
Cleaning · Maintenance
Clean luminaire regularly with solvent-free cleansers from dirt and deposits.
Do not use high pressure cleaners.
Please note:
Do not remove the desiccant bag from the luminaire housing.
It is needed to remove residual moisture.
Replacing the LED module
The designation of the LED module is noted on a label in the luminaire.
The light colour and light output of BEGA replacement modules correspond to those of the modules originally fitted.
The module can be replaced by qualified persons using standard tools.
Disconnect the system and open the luminaire.
Please follow the installation instructions for the LED module.
Inspect and, if necessary, replace the luminaire gaskets.
Defective glass must be replaced.
Close the luminaire.
